Choosing Digital Tools for Efficient Repair Documentation

In today’s digital age, efficient repair documentation is a cornerstone for any automotive body shop or auto maintenance facility. Choosing the right digital tools can significantly streamline this process, enhancing accuracy and productivity in vehicle collision repair. One of the key benefits is the ability to capture detailed, visual information swiftly and securely. For instance, high-resolution cameras integrated with repair documentation software allow technicians to document damage, track progress, and generate comprehensive reports effortlessly.
A robust digital solution should offer versatile features tailored to auto maintenance needs. Consider tools that facilitate photo annotation, enabling professionals to highlight specific areas of concern or mark repair milestones. Automated data capture from vehicle identification numbers (VIN) streamlines initial assessments and ensures consistent record-keeping. Furthermore, cloud-based storage integrates seamlessly with existing shop management systems, facilitating easy retrieval and sharing of documents among team members. According to industry surveys, digital documentation can reduce errors by up to 30%, leading to faster turnaround times and increased customer satisfaction in vehicle collision repair services.
When selecting a digital tool for repair documentation service, prioritize platforms that offer scalable solutions adaptable to the unique workflows of your auto maintenance facility. Easy-to-use interfaces ensure minimal training time while maximizing productivity. Implementing Best Practices in Photo Documentation

In the digital age, accurate photo documentation is an indispensable component of any repair documentation service, especially within the automotive industry where precision and attention to detail are paramount. For instance, consider the meticulous process of Mercedes-Benz repair or vehicle restoration—each step requires clear, comprehensive records for both historical reference and quality control. High-resolution images taken at various stages of a repair project not only serve as visual aids but also facilitate seamless communication among technicians, ensuring everyone is aligned with the vehicle’s current state.
Implementing best practices in photo documentation involves strategic consistency and organization. Automotive repair professionals should establish a standardized system for capturing and storing images, including specific angles, lighting conditions, and clear labeling. For example, documenting both close-up and wide-angle views of a car’s engine during restoration allows for a holistic understanding of the repair process. Additionally, utilizing cloud-based platforms ensures easy accessibility to these digital records, enabling quick reference and facilitating efficient collaboration among team members.
Beyond mere documentation, leveraging advanced tools like specialized software or mobile apps can enhance this process. These applications often include features such as overlay measurements, annotated image editing, and automated report generation. When integrated into a repair documentation service, these digital tools streamline workflow, minimize errors, and ultimately elevate the overall quality of vehicle restoration projects. Enhancing Accuracy: Advanced Features in Repair Documentation Services

In the realm of auto repair, meticulous record-keeping is paramount to ensuring customer satisfaction and maintaining high standards. Digital tools have transformed how repair documentation services are executed, offering advanced features that enhance accuracy and efficiency. These innovations cater to various auto repair needs, from tire services to car dent removal, providing a comprehensive solution for workshops and mechanics worldwide.
One of the most significant advantages is the ability to capture detailed, high-resolution images of damaged components. Modern repair documentation software enables users to take close-up pictures, ensuring every crack, scratch, or dent is visible. For instance, a study by Auto Body Repair & Paint (ABRP) found that digital documentation reduced human error in damage assessment by 42%. This level of precision is crucial for accurate insurance claims and customer transparency. Moreover, these platforms often incorporate measuring tools, allowing mechanics to record exact dimensions and angles, which is particularly useful during complex repairs like body panel replacement or car dent removal.
Advanced features also include cloud storage and easy-to-use interfaces. Mechanics can access previous repair records quickly, compare before-and-after photos, and generate detailed reports with just a few clicks. This streamlined process not only saves time but also improves communication between workshops, mechanics, and clients. For example, tire services providers can efficiently document tread wear patterns, sidewall damage, or misalignments, providing clear evidence for insurance claims or customer education.
